What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.100(a): Employees working in areas where there is a possible danger of head injury from impact, or from falling or flying objects, or from electrical shock and burns, were not protected by protective helmets.    a) Loading dock, 720 Firestone Ave, Memphis, TN 38107 On or about 10 Mar 2020, the employer did not ensure that employees were wearing protective helmets while working overhead and exposed to falling tools or materials.

29 CFR 1926.102(a)(1): The employer did not ensure that each affected employee uses appropriate eye or face protection when exposed to eye or face hazards from flying particles, molten metal, liquid chemicals, acids or caustic liquids, chemical gases or vapors, or potentially injurious light radiation.    a) Loading dock, 720 Firestone Ave, Memphis, TN 38107. On or about 10 Mar 2020, the employer did not ensure that employees were wearing eye protection while working overhead using a cordless drill exposing employees to eye injury.

29 CFR 1926.302(e)(11): All tools were not used with the correct shield, guard, or attachment recommended by the manufacturer.    a) Loading dock, 720 Firestone Ave, Memphis, TN 38107 On or about 10 Mar 2020, the employer did not ensure that the Porter Cable tool had a guard in place while cutting vinyl soffit material exposing employee to laceration hazards.

29 CFR 1926.1060(a): The employer did not provide a training program for each employee using ladders and stairways, as necessary. The program shall enable each employee to recognize hazards related to ladders and stairways, and shall train each employee in the procedures to be followed to minimize these hazards.  a) Loading dock, 720 Firestone Ave, Memphis, TN 38107 On or about 10 Mar 2020, employees exposed to fall hazards were not trained in the proper use of ladders.
